fca shipping definition stands for “Free Carrier,” an international trade term from Incoterms 2020. Under FCA, the seller delivers goods to a carrier or another person nominated by the buyer at the seller’s premises or another named location. The risk transfers once the goods are handed over. This term is often used in sea freight and air cargo, clarifying responsibilities and reducing misunderstandings between buyers and sellers. Proper use of FCA helps manage shipping risks and ensures smoother transactions in global trade.
